Specific Volatility Levels By Asset

Volatility comparison:

Bitcoin: 60-80% annualized volatility.

Ethereum: 70-90% annualized volatility.

Altcoins: 80-150%+ annualized volatility.

Stablecoins: Minimal volatility (designed to track $1).

Specific Portfolio Allocation Context

Allocation framework:

Small allocation context: 5% crypto allocation. Even 80% drawdown = 4% portfolio impact.

Specific Volatility Versus Permanent Loss

Important distinction:

Volatility: Price fluctuation. Recovers over time historically.

Permanent loss: Failed companies, scams, etc. No recovery.
